Sample translated sentence: You're not the first clergyman I've seen in his underpants. ↔ Usted no es el primer clérigo que he visto en calzoncillos. clergymannoungrammar An ordained Christian minister. +Add translationAddclergyman WebJul 4, 2012 · The convention in Spain seems to be for priests: Don First Name - or Padre First Name Similarly for monks - many of whom are priests and not brothers. They will correct you if they wish. Nuns - Hermana. I always use Usted unless they "Tu" me then I reciprocate in that form. I suspect many expect always to be Usted Camino Jewellery ian watson nice https://lutzlandsurveying.com
